Assistant General Manager - Retail DFW Airport
Paradies LagardèreAbout the role
The ideal candidate will have 7 plus years in big box retail with well-known companies including convenience stores, sales experience and a desire to join an exciting, energetic and trend setting airport concessionaire. Will be managing over 10 million dollars in retail business. Must be a people person with a track record of developing teams and talent. This role drives the company’s key performance metrics by delivering an exceptional customer store experience through the associates they manage.
